Quinta Vale Dona Maria is an opulent red wine from the Douro Region. Loaded with intense aromas of ripe black fruits, presents excellent wood notes, balsamic aromas, notes of black chocolate, dried tobacco leaf and spices. It is an imposing red wine, with fruity and fleshy tannins along with an extraordinary acidity and a great minerality.

Winemaking:
Quinta Vale Dona Maria is a red wine, produced from the old vines with more than 60 years old, of the Quinta Vale Dona Maria, in the Douro region. After grapes being foot trodding in granitic Lagares, the wine was fermented for 10 days in contact of the skins and the stalks, at controlled temperatures. The wine was then transferred for new's French oak barrels (75% of the batch) and for 1-year-old used's French oak barrels (25%of the batch), where it stayed for 21 months, prior to being blended and bottled.
Grape Varieties:
Old Vines of Touriga Franca, Touriga Nacional, Tinta Roriz, Tinto Cão, Tinta Francisca, Malvasia Preta, Tinta Francisca, Bastardinho, Rufete, Tinta Amarela, Tinta Francisca, Sousão.
Tasting Notes:
Quinta Vale Dona Maria is a very concentrated red wine from the Douro Valley, full of aromatic intensity alongside a great freshness and minerality. It presents great notes of the evolution of the aging in wood such as notes of vanilla, spices, black pepper, clove, leaves of dry tobacco all in harmony with the residual sugars of the fantástic concentration of the fruits.
Store and Serve Advice:
Store in a cool place (15ºC). Serve at 16ºC-18ºC.
